Power Capacity Needs
Choosing the right UPS for your gaming PC starts with understanding its power capacity needs. I recommend selecting a UPS with at least 1500VA/900W to support high-performance gaming setups and peripherals during outages. It’s important to regard the total wattage of all connected devices, including monitors, consoles, and accessories, to guarantee the UPS can handle the load. A higher VA rating means more backup runtime, which is crucial for extended gaming sessions or long outages. Look for models with pure sine wave output to provide stable, clean power, protecting sensitive gaming hardware. Additionally, evaluate the battery capacity and backup time to make sure your setup can stay operational long enough for you to save progress and shut down properly. This assures uninterrupted gaming and data safety.
Battery Longevity Expectations
Long-lasting batteries are essential for ensuring your gaming PC stays powered through outages, so I always look for models with a lifespan of over 10 years. A longer battery life means reliable backup during unexpected power cuts, saving my gaming sessions. Batteries with high cycle counts, like 3,000+, can be recharged many times without losing considerable capacity, which extends usability. I prefer Lithium Iron Phosphate (LiFePO4) batteries because they’re maintenance-free and last longer than traditional lead-acid types. Proper care also matters—avoiding deep discharges and keeping the battery healthy can markedly boost its lifespan. Additionally, UPS systems with advanced battery management systems help monitor and optimize battery health over time, ensuring consistent performance and a longer overall lifespan.
Surge Protection Features
Have you ever experienced a sudden power surge that risked damaging your gaming PC? Surge protection features in UPS systems are essential to prevent voltage spikes from harming your components. Look for units with Joule ratings of at least 600-1000; higher ratings mean better absorption of power surges. Metal oxide varistors (MOVs) are also indispensable, as they help clamp high-voltage transients and protect your system. Many UPS models include dedicated surge-only outlets, which isolate surges from critical backup outlets, adding an extra layer of security. Additionally, always check that the surge protection certifications, like UL or IEEE standards, are current. Reliable surge protection ensures your gaming rig stays safe during unexpected electrical events, prolonging its lifespan and maintaining uninterrupted play.
Compatibility With PC
When selecting a UPS for your gaming PC, compatibility features can make or break your setup’s reliability. First, make sure it provides a sine wave output, especially if your PC has active PFC power supplies, which need clean power to run smoothly. Check that the UPS’s wattage capacity is at least 900W to support your system’s power draw during outages without shutting down unexpectedly. Confirm the number and type of outlets match your setup’s needs, including peripherals. Support for automatic voltage regulation (AVR) is essential to handle power fluctuations safely. Finally, verify the presence of compatible communication ports like USB or network connections, so you can manage the UPS easily and enable automatic shutdowns during extended outages. These compatibility features ensure your gaming experience remains seamless and protected.
Runtime Duration
Choosing the right UPS for your gaming PC hinges on understanding its runtime duration, which directly impacts your ability to finish a game or save your progress during an outage. The runtime depends on the UPS’s capacity (VA/W) and the total load of your connected equipment. Higher-capacity units generally provide longer backup times, giving you more time to shut down properly or continue playing seamlessly. Battery technology, like lithium-ion, can also extend runtime because it’s more efficient and longer-lasting. To choose wisely, consider your PC’s power consumption and peripherals, then select a UPS with a capacity that exceeds your total load. Many models display estimated runtimes on LCD screens or via management software, helping you plan for unexpected outages effectively.

Size and Placement
Ensuring your UPS size matches your gaming PC and peripherals is vital for providing enough backup time without risking overload. I recommend calculating your total power requirements and choosing a UPS with a capacity slightly above that to guarantee reliability. Additionally, consider the physical dimensions and weight of the unit—make certain it fits comfortably in your designated gaming space without cluttering or obstructing airflow. Proper placement is crucial; position the UPS where it can ventilate freely and isn’t exposed to dust, moisture, or direct sunlight, which can affect performance and lifespan. If space is limited, opt for a compact model, but if you have a more extensive setup, a larger UPS with more outlets and higher capacity may be necessary to support all your gear comfortably.
